Output 6b489291fd81fd14dc93b78f1c21bee5c1818087377b65d1b1d3042e267c9400:1

value
25430310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 885ec3bc20860091aa0e8e77e4bdc8b789f8c7b6 OP_EQUAL
address
MLLDestbi8NgXnuEnb4nSKjprqUkXem2Hf
transaction
6b489291fd81fd14dc93b78f1c21bee5c1818087377b65d1b1d3042e267c9400
spent
true